It's times like this that I'm so, so glad I picked up the original when I did. I can't believe how expensive it's gotten. Trust me though, you will be very hard pressed to find this game for less than $40. I'll tell ya; even after 11 years, the artwork in the original still looks amazing. Also, I think McGee said something along the lines that EA actually lost the source code for the game.

Yeah, the "gun" she's using literally is a pepper grinder (from 'Word of God'). In the original, the Duchess (the first boss) attacks you with one, although you never get to use it. This looks like what I hoping it'd be, but my main concern is that the gameplay will be too God of War-ish. The original was a true TPS, where the camera was always behind Alice by default, although you could manually rotate it. This made it easy to control, much like an FPS. The trailer sort of appears that the camera angles may be all over the place which I think would make the combat feel less natural. I hope this isn't the case.
